- uint64_t new_number;
- memcached_return_t rc;
- const char *value= "3";
-
- rc= memcached_set(memc,
- test_literal_param("number"),
- value, strlen(value),
- (time_t)0, (uint32_t)0);
- test_true(rc == MEMCACHED_SUCCESS or rc == MEMCACHED_BUFFERED);
+ test_compare(return_value_based_on_buffering(memc),
+ memcached_set(memc,
+ test_literal_param(__func__),
+ test_literal_param("3"),
+ time_t(0), uint32_t(0)));
+ // Make sure we flush the value we just set
+ test_compare(MEMCACHED_SUCCESS, memcached_flush_buffers(memc));